首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用pandoc将markdown转换为不同大小的HTML

使用pandoc将Markdown转换为不同大小的HTML可以通过指定不同的CSS样式来实现。下面是一个完善且全面的答案:

Markdown是一种轻量级的标记语言,用于简化文本的格式化和排版。而pandoc是一个强大的文档转换工具,可以将Markdown转换为多种格式,包括HTML。

要将Markdown转换为不同大小的HTML,可以通过以下步骤进行操作:

  1. 安装pandoc:首先需要在本地安装pandoc。可以从pandoc的官方网站(https://pandoc.org/)下载适合您操作系统的安装包,并按照安装指南进行安装。
  2. 创建Markdown文件:使用任何文本编辑器创建一个Markdown文件,将需要转换的内容写入其中。Markdown语法非常简单,您可以使用标题、段落、列表、链接、图片等基本元素来组织文本。
  3. 创建CSS样式文件:根据您想要的不同大小的HTML样式,创建一个CSS文件。您可以使用CSS来定义字体、字号、行高、边距等样式属性。确保CSS文件与Markdown文件在同一目录下。
  4. 执行转换命令:打开命令行终端,导航到Markdown文件所在的目录,并执行以下命令:
  5. 执行转换命令:打开命令行终端,导航到Markdown文件所在的目录,并执行以下命令:
  6. 其中,input.md是您的Markdown文件名,output.html是生成的HTML文件名,style.css是您创建的CSS文件名。执行命令后,pandoc将会将Markdown文件转换为HTML,并应用指定的CSS样式。
  7. 查看转换结果:在转换完成后,您可以在同一目录下找到生成的HTML文件。使用任何现代的Web浏览器打开HTML文件,即可查看转换后的效果。

这是使用pandoc将Markdown转换为不同大小的HTML的基本步骤。根据您的需求,您可以根据CSS样式的不同来调整HTML的大小和样式。希望这个答案对您有帮助!

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云区块链服务(BCS):https://cloud.tencent.com/product/bcs
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

javascript html转换成markdown,如何使用Turndown使用JavaScriptHTML换为Markdown

例如, 一个基本博客可能从一开始就使用HTML格式将其内容存储在数据库中, 但是由于其简单性, 总有一天某人可能希望开始使用Markdown而不是HTML, 在这种情况下, 你需要从一种格式转换为另一种格式...如果你服务器端逻辑与JavaScript(Node.js)一起使用, 甚至直接在浏览器中将HTML换为编辑器中Markdown, 则可以使用Turndown库轻松地完成此类任务, HTML到用JavaScript...在本文中, 我们向你展示如何在Node.js甚至浏览器中将HTML换为Markdown。有关该库更多信息, 请访问Github上官方存储库, 或访问官方主页以在线测试转换器。...创建turndown服务实例并将其存储到变量中, 从该变量执行turndown方法, 将要转换为markdownHTML字符串作为第一个参数, 就是这样: // Import Turndown module...包含脚本之后, 你应该能够使用前面工作方式中提到相同逻辑HTML换为markdown: // Create an instance of the turndown service var turndownService

3.8K10

如何使用 Python Word 文档转换为 HTMLMarkdown

最近有一个开发需求,生成word数据报表以网页格式推送,正好找到一个简单快速转换模块mammoth。...这篇简短文章指导您如何在基于 Python CLI — Mammoth帮助下,以简单方式.docx word 文档转换为简单网页文档 ( .html ) 或 Markdown 文档 (...而且,您可能希望文档内容作为 Web 文档 ( .html )) 或 Markdown 文档 ( .md )与您一些朋友、同事、客户共享。...然后,打开 CMD 或终端并使用以下命令: pip install mammoth Docx 转换为HTML 使用命令行: $ mammoth input_name.docx output_name.html...(docx_file) with open("sample.html", "w") as html_file: html_file.write(result.value) Docx 转换为MD

2.6K20

使用 PandocMarkdown Docx

最近在写文档,但是有小伙伴比较渣,他只会使用 Word 为了照顾这些比较渣小伙伴,我需要把我 Markdown 文件转换为 Word 给他们。...下载 然后使用命令行进入 Pandoc 解压出来路径,例如我需要把 E:\lindexi\win10 uwp 如何开始开发.md转换为win10 uwp 如何开始开发.docx,那么就需要使用下面的代码...pandoc.exe -s -o "E:\lindexi\win10 uwp 如何开始开发.docx" "E:\lindexi\win10 uwp 如何开始开发.md" --mathjax 这里代码意思是...我自己尝试了转换,感觉不错 实际上 pandoc 是强大文档转换工具,可以相互转换下面的格式 pdf word markdown tex html 如果需要做 Latex... pdf 也可以使用这个工具,参见 You got LaTeX in my Markdown!

1.9K10

为什么我要用markdown写word

Word 不便 排版不稳定: 在 Microsoft Word 中,即使在同一台电脑上使用同一个版本软件,不同文档在不同电脑上打开也会出现格式错乱情况,导致排版不稳定。...mdword方案 Markdown是一种纯文本标记语言,它优点在于它简单易学,易于阅读和编写。...但是,如果您需要将Markdown格式文档转换为Microsoft Word格式文档,可能需要一些额外工作。下面是几种Markdown换为Word方案。...Pandoc支持Markdown换为多种格式,包括Word格式。Pandoc支持Windows、Mac OS X和Linux等多个操作系统。...您可以使用以下命令Markdown文件转换为Word文件: pandoc input.md -o output.docx 其中,input.md是您要转换Markdown文件名,output.docx

2.8K30

一种高兼容度通用文档解决方案

不得不说,就连微软自己 office 系列软件定位就是指一款 文字处理软件,在这样软件之上可以完成几乎所有的格式调整工作,但并不保证不同设备、软件之间可以互相通用;此外如果是记录笔记或是进行文字创作...今天主要使用 Pandoc 由 .md .docx 功能将 Markdown 文件转换为 word 等软件可直接使用文档格式。 ?...首先安装 Pandoc,这个不同版本安装方法不同,烹茶室 使用基于 Ubuntu Linux 发行版只需要使用下列命令即可完成安装: $ sudo apt-get install pandoc...使用下列命令就可以 Markdown 文档转换为 docx,还可以直接生成 html等格式: $ pandoc test.md -o test.docx $ pandoc test.md -o test.html...使用markdown撰写源文档,可直接发布到博客平台,使用 pandoc换为docx格式就可以直接导入秀米进行排版,使用markdown甚至还可以直接撰写ppt(nodeppt),写代码也可以干得过写

1K40

纯Python 实现 Word 文档转换 Markdown

于此我们需要将其转换为 Markdown 语法。 很多桌面软件(比如 Typora)都提供了导入 Word 文件功能,这类功能一般是通过 Pandoc 这个软件来扩展实现。...Pandoc 是一个全能型文档格式转换工具,其能够多种文档格式转换为各类常见文档格式。具体文档格式之间转换如下图所示(来源于官网): ?...幸而,在 Python 中有很多第三方模块提供了此类文档格式转换功能。今天,我们来实现一下比较频繁使用 Word 文档 Markdown 文档。...转换逻辑 Word 文档到 Markdown 文档转换总体而言分两步来实现: 第一步, Word 文档转换为 HTML 文档; 第二步, HTML 文档转换为 Markdown 文档; 依赖模块...而 markdownify 则是 HTML换为 Markdown 文档模块。

4.2K62

使用markdown,knitr和pandoc在R语言中编写可重现报告

在本指南中,我们想向您展示如何使用现在提供一些奇妙,免费工具和软件包编写美观,可重复报告。这些工具帮助您交流科学知识,并希望您再也不会复制和粘贴R输出。...点击可以 knit HTML 做几件事 它运行文件中所有代码 它会生成一个markdown文件,包括原始文档位及其输出。 它将markdown文档转换为html。...转换为不同文档格式 现在,如果要生成其他文档类型而不是html文件怎么办?输入pandoc。...根据其创建者说法 ,“如果您需要将文件从一种标记格式转换为另一种标记格式,那么pandoc是您瑞士军刀。...它还可以在安装LaTeX系统上产生PDF输出。”” 首先,您需要下载并 安装pandoc。安装后,您便可以使用pnadoc knitr软件包随附 功能将生成md文件转换为所需任何格式。

2.2K11

WPF 使用 PandocMarkdown Docx 选择文件获取文件文件夹使用资源管理器打开文件夹选择指定文件

本文告诉大家如何通过 WPF 使用 PandocMarkdown Docx 文件 在之前有文章使用 PandocMarkdown Docx但是这里方法需要每次都调用命令行,本文提供方法封装了命令行...界面很简单,就不告诉大家如何做出这样界面了,现在是来解决一些坑 选择文件 从软件界面看到,可以让用户选择需要转换文件,选择文件可以通过 OpenFileDialog 让用户选择文件...pandoc; 通过 Path.GetDirectoryName(_markdown) 可以拿到对应文件文件夹 使用资源管理器打开文件夹选择指定文件 在转换完成之后,让用户资源管理器打开 Word...("explorer.exe", argument); 我软件放在 csdn 和 github 可以通过点击下面的网站下载 使用 PandocMarkdown Docx-CSDN下载 软件使用方式.../post/WPF-%E4%BD%BF%E7%94%A8-Pandoc-%E6%8A%8A-Markdown-%E8%BD%AC-Docx.html ,以避免陈旧错误知识误导,同时有更好阅读体验

1.2K20

API管理-舍弃springfox-swagger-ui,采用功能更加丰富swagger-bootstrap-ui

支持接口pdf和word和markdwon方式对接口文档进行导出,wagger-bootstrap-ui 提供markdwon格式类型离线文档,开发者可拷贝该内容通过其他markdown转换工具进行转换为...如果markdown(.md)文件快速导出成html或word文件 swagger-bootstrap-ui 提供markdwon格式类型离线文档,开发者可拷贝该内容通过其他markdown转换工具进行转换为...pandoc下载地址:https://github.com/jgm/pandoc/releases/tag/2.2 1》按照md->HTML->PDF路径。...于是先把md转为HTMLHTML样式倒是挺美观,然后在浏览器中使用浏览器打印功能把HTML转为PDF。...2》md->docx->PDF(推荐) pandoc -s test.md -o test.docx pandoc -f markdown -t html -o test.html readme.md

1.9K40

Windwos 安装Pandoc 工具,实现Typora 文档导出为docx

gitHub地址为:https://github.com/jgm/pandoc/ 是一个用于从一种标记格式转换为另一种标记格式Haskell库,也是一个使用该库命令行工具。...安装Pandoc 安装方式比价简单,通过:https://github.com/jgm/pandoc/releases 选择不同系统版本进行安装就可以了: windows系统安装比较简单。...下面列一些基本操作命令: txt文件转换为html文件: pandoc MANUAL.txt -o example1.html txt文件转为rtf文件: pandoc -s MANUAL.txt...Typora 添加Pandoc 当我们本地安装好Pandoc之后,就可以路径配置到Typora中,这样Typora在进行导出为word文档时,就会自动调用相关转换命令,将我们markdown文档转换为...选择:pandoc.exe 文件后,点击确认就可以Pandoc配置完毕了。 配置完毕效果如下: 之后,我们就可以正常使用Typora进行各种文件导出了。

2.6K20

用Python实现markdown批量word文档

Pythonmd批量转为docx 这两天发现了一个可以markdown快速转为word格式小工具pandoc, 非常好用, 比如我有一个名为Python资料.md文件, 我只需在命令行运行 pandoc...pandoc支持相互转换格式, 多惊人! ? Pandoc主站链接:https://pandoc.org/index.html ?...使用技巧: 由于word确实很难用, 我们可以用md格式书写, 然后转换成docx 懒是第一生产力, pandoc可以在命令行运行, 所以, 我们可以配合python脚本md格式批量转换为docx 这是我写一个简易脚本...最终结果 值得一提是, 我这里用md测试文件, 都是从我简书后台打包下载, 也就是本地是不存在图片, 而pandoc会自动帮我们把图片下载到本地, 然后保存到新生成doc中....只要将我脚本稍加修改, 就可以按照上面的网状图, 进行任意两种格式互转(比如wordpdf), 有兴趣小伙伴可以自己动手折腾一下

3.2K30

Pandoc快速转换Word到Markdown文件

Pandoc是一款非常强大文档格式转换工具,对于WordMarkdown场景,可以快速实现转换,并且把Word文件中图片,生成到指定文件夹中。...Pandoc是由John MacFarlane开发标记语言转换工具,可实现不同标记语言间格式转换,堪称该领域中“瑞士军刀”。...上面是引用,关于Pandoc介绍。 pandoc -f docx -t markdown test.docx -o test.md --extract-media ..../images Word文档中图片 Word文档 转换后Markdown文件 Pandoc还支持,直接通过Http协议访问网页内容,并生成Markdown文件,远端Web服务器上图片也可以...pandoc -f html -t markdown --request-header User-Agent:“Mozilla/5.0” https://candylab.net/design/HFishSOC

1.9K30

WPF 使用 PandocMarkdown Docx

本文告诉大家如何通过 WPF 使用 PandocMarkdown Docx 文件 在之前有文章使用 PandocMarkdown Docx但是这里方法需要每次都调用命令行,本文提供方法封装了命令行...,有一个界面可以快速做转换 界面很简单,就不告诉大家如何做出这样界面了,现在是来解决一些坑 选择文件 从软件界面看到,可以让用户选择需要转换文件,选择文件可以通过 OpenFileDialog 让用户选择文件...是使用 lindexi.wpf.Framework 这个库,通过 Nuget 安装 定义了 ViewModel 类,这个类只有三个属性 public string Markdown...pandoc; 通过 Path.GetDirectoryName(_markdown) 可以拿到对应文件文件夹 使用资源管理器打开文件夹选择指定文件 在转换完成之后,让用户资源管理器打开 Word...("explorer.exe", argument); 我软件放在 csdn 和 github 可以通过点击下面的网站下载 使用 PandocMarkdown Docx-CSDN下载 软件使用方式

52120

markdown 目录一键生成和转为 word 格式

一、背景 通常作为技术人,写技术文章或者专栏我更喜欢使用 typora 编写 markdown 格式,因为不需要太关注格式,让我能更关注内容。 但是如果文章章节较多时,希望可以自动生成目录。...一个简单做法就是 markdown 粘贴到 bear 笔记里,再一键生成目录,然后导出到 PDF,但是 bear 中导出 PDF 是收费,肿么办? 下面给出一个免费转换方式。...二、操作 2.1 安装 pandoc 根据自己系统,选择对应安装包: https://github.com/jgm/pandoc/releases 2.2 执行命令 2.2.1 生成目录 在命令行中...2.2.3 转成 PDF 命令如下: pandoc xxx.md --pdf-engine=xelatex -o xxxx.pdf 2.2.4 epub 格式 pandoc xxx.md -o...xxxx.epub 其他指令参考 https://pandoc.org/demos.html 三、总结 很多 markdown 工具转换格式底层就是用 pandoc ,如果该工具转换部分是收费

2K20
领券